Transaction d6926b1433c39789ef3ece1d5a567311ff3b23dec03591a8f30981472098fe43

1 Input
1 Outputs
  • d6926b1433c39789ef3ece1d5a567311ff3b23dec03591a8f30981472098fe43:0
  • value  212991
    address  34mRuA2ChdSxRRGg4gv39DL9PD7JhJhTWm